The parenting style that creates leaders
The more overprotective their parents, the less the teens were perceived as having leadership potential by others, and the less likely they were to actually be in leadership roles
Overparenting may also create this undermining effect because it signals to children that they are not capable of independence
Those who have been overprotected have often been overpraised as a matter of course, and don’t cope as well with constructive criticism.
For you to improve you need to be open to suggestions of what you need to do to progress.

Meals based on vegetable protein sources (beans and peas) are more satiating (2016)
Vegetable-based meals (beans/peas) influenced appetite sensations favorably compared to animal-based meals (pork/veal) with similar energy and protein content, but lower fiber content. Interestingly, a vegetable-based meal with low protein content was as satiating and palatable as an animal-based meal with high protein content.
